IP address 95.66.197.128 lookup, whois and location finder

IP address  95.66.197.128
95.66.197.128  Russian Federation
IPv4
95.66.197.128
Limited Liability Company VLADINFO
Limited Liability Company VLADINFO
95.66.197.0 - 95.66.197.255
Europe/Moscow (UTC+3)
Russian Federation 
Vladimir
Kovrov
56.357200622559, 41.319198608398
Show